Understanding Solar Power Generation
A 1 kW solar panel system consists of several solar panels that collectively generate one kilowatt of electricity under optimal conditions. The amount of electricity produced can vary based on factors such as location, sunlight exposure, and the efficiency of the solar panels. Generally, a 1 kW system can produce around 4 to 5 kWh of electricity per day, depending on these variables. This can significantly reduce reliance on the grid and lower electricity bills.
Benefits of 1 kW Solar Panels
1. Cost-Effective Solution One of the most compelling reasons to invest in a 1 kW solar panel system is its affordability. Smaller systems are typically less expensive to install, making them accessible to a broader range of homeowners. Additionally, many governments offer incentives, rebates, and tax credits for solar installations, which can further reduce the initial investment.
2. Space Efficiency For those with limited roof space, a 1 kW solar panel system can be an ideal solution. It requires less area compared to larger installations, making it suitable for urban homes or properties with smaller roofs. Moreover, advances in solar panel technology have led to the development of compact and efficient panels that maximize energy generation in minimal space.
3. Environmental Impact By harnessing the power of the sun, homeowners can significantly reduce their carbon footprint. Solar energy is a clean and renewable source, and utilizing a 1 kW system contributes to decreased greenhouse gas emissions. This aligns with global efforts to combat climate change and promotes a more sustainable future.
4. Energy Independence A 1 kW solar panel system empowers homeowners by providing greater control over their energy consumption. By generating their own electricity, they become less dependent on utility providers and are less susceptible to rising energy prices. This independence can lead to long-term savings and financial stability.
5. Low Maintenance Costs Once installed, solar panels generally require minimal maintenance. Regular cleaning and occasional inspections are typically sufficient to keep the system operating efficiently. This contrasts with traditional energy systems that may require more frequent repairs or upgrades.
